Account Manager, PCS, China
ICON plc is a world-leading healthcare intelligence and clinical research organization. We’re proud to foster an inclusive environment driving innovation and excellence, and we welcome you to join us on our mission to shape the future of clinical development.
As an Account Manager, Patient Centred Solutions (PCS) at ICON, you will manage client relationships, coordinating the development of compelling proposals.
What You Will Do:
You will manage day-to-day account management and client services activities, supporting your team to deliver quality outcomes.
Key responsibilities include:
- Managing a portfolio of active clients, including client communications, outreach, and coordination of RFI/RFP responses with all stakeholders as needed.
- Efficiently qualifying client requests to streamline the process.
- Collaborating with operational teams and suppliers to create compelling and competitive proposals.
- Explaining and promoting the company's products and services to maintain and expand the current and prospective client base.
- Participating in meetings with internal and external clients on operational topics, whether through conference calls or face-to-face meetings.
- Ensuring the delivery of finished products at the expected level of quality within set timelines.
- Providing administrative follow-up for projects from launch to finalization.
Your Profile:
You will have solid account management and client services experience, with the ability to manage competing priorities and develop your team.
Required qualifications and experience:
- Bachelor's degree in a relevant discipline
- Excellent customer service skills, including the ability to communicate clearly with clients and resolve customer issues or complaints.
- A minimum of 3 years of experience in client services and account management.
- Experience in the domain of clinical outcomes assessments is a plus.
- A process-driven approach with strong attention to detail and superior organizational skills.
- Dedicated team player, capable of working both independently and collaboratively.
- The ability to manage multiple tasks simultaneously and independently.
